Amentum in the United Kingdom is seeking a Subject Matter Expert for water quality and water management to support the Sizewell C construction phase. You will provide technical assurance, regulatory oversight, and specialist advice on discharges, flood risk, permits, licences, and environmental compliance, partnering with delivery teams and regulators.
